Summary
We are seeking a detail-oriented and proactive Production Assistant to manage and execute all transactions within our internal ERP system (Business Central). This role is pivotal in ensuring accurate and timely creation of production orders for supervisors across various production lines. The ideal candidate will have a strong understanding of ERP systems, exceptional organizational skills, and the ability to handle multiple tasks efficiently.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ities include the following:
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.
· ERP Transactions: Utilize Business Central to create and manage production orders, ensuring that all orders are accurately entered and processed according to production schedules and requirements.
· Order Management: Work closely with production supervisors to gather and verify production order details, including materials, quantities, and schedules. Ensure that all orders are properly documented and reflect the latest production plans.
· Data Accuracy: Maintain high levels of accuracy and attention to detail when entering data into the ERP system. Regularly review and reconcile production orders to identify and correct any discrepancies or errors.
· Coordination: Coordinate with production supervisors to ensure that their production orders are fulfilled in a timely manner. Address any issues or changes promptly and communicate updates effectively.
· Reporting: Generate and review reports related to production orders and ERP transactions. Provide insights and updates to management on order status, production progress, and any potential issues.
· Process Improvement: Identify and suggest improvements to the ERP transaction process to enhance efficiency and accuracy. Participate in training and development to stay current with ERP system updates and best practices.
· Compliance: Ensure that all transactions and production orders comply with company policies and procedures, as well as relevant industry standards and regulations.
